Medical Health / PAR-Q
 

Before starting your training you will be asked to complete a medical health PAR-Q (Physical activity readiness questionnaire) so that we know you are safe to commence an exercise programme. 


If you have answered 'YES' to one or more questions on the Medical Health Form:
Talk to your instructor and ensure that they are aware of these. Your instructor may restrict your physical involvement in activity and offer you advice of your restrictions. Depending on the severity of these positive answers your instructor may ask you to refrain from activity before seeking medical advice from your GP. If this is the case you will be required to tell your GP about the questions you answered positively to, then approval to exercise will need to be obtained before full physical commencement of any exercise program. 

 

If you have answered 'NO' to all questions on the Medical Health Form:
You can be reasonably sure that you are safe to exercise and therefore will be able to fully participate in your chosen activity. If you have any concerns please speak to your instructor and always work within your own limits Remember - begin slowly and build up gradually.

Please note: If your health changes so that subsequently you answer 'YES' to any of the above questions, inform your fitness or health professional immediately. Ask whether you should change your physical activity, exercise plan, or seek a doctor’s referral. Delay becoming more active if you feel unwell because of a temporary illness such as flu - wait until you are better.
